This fascinating book on mandates provides a thorough examination of the legal framework surrounding mandates, delving into the obligations and rights of both the principal and the agent. The author draws upon a wealth of jurisprudence to illustrate the practical applications of mandate law, making the book a valuable resource for legal professionals and laypeople alike. The book begins by exploring the nature of mandates, differentiating them from other contractual agreements and establishing their unique characteristics. It then comprehensively analyzes the obligations of the mandatary, including their duty to execute the mandate diligently and to account for their actions. The author also examines the mandatary's liability for damages resulting from their negligence or misconduct, highlighting the distinction between gratuitous and salaried mandates. Furthermore, the book delves into the rights of the principal, discussing their ability to revoke the mandate and seek recourse in the event of a breach. It also examines the legal framework governing the termination of mandates, including the consequences of the mandatary's death or incapacity. Overall, this in-depth and practical book provides a comprehensive understanding of mandates, making it an essential guide for anyone seeking to navigate the legal complexities surrounding this type of contractual agreement. Add to basketPaperback. Condition: New. Print on Demand. This book presents a comprehensive study of the separation of bodies in Roman Catholic doctrine. It begins by offering a concise history of the practice, starting with an examination of its biblical origins and tracing its evolution through the Middle Ages and up to the present day. The author then provides an in-depth analysis of the legal framework surrounding separation of bodies, discussing the grounds for seeking it, the procedures involved, and the effects it has on the marital relationship. The author concludes by examining the theological significance of separation of bodies, exploring its relationship to the sacrament of marriage and the broader concept of Christian morality. This book will be of interest to scholars of religious studies, law, and history, as well as anyone interested in the complexities of marriage and separation in the Catholic tradition.
